English: Drawing of Sepulchral brass of Agnes Jordan, last pre-reformation Abbess of Syon Monastery, Isleworth, at her burial place in Denham, Bucks. 16th c., decade of death obliterated from monument: "Of your charity pray for the sowle of Dame Agnes Jordan, sometyme abbesse of the monasterye of Syon, which departed this lyfe the 29 of Januarye in the year of our Lord 15.. on whose soule Jesu have mercye Amen".
